## Break-Glass Access: Resizely CLI

Plugin authors extending the Resizely batch image resizer occasionally need emergency access to the signing vault when the normal token service at Quellhaven is unreachable. Break-glass access bypasses the plugin review gate and should be used only when a release is blocked and no maintainer is available. All break-glass sessions are logged and reviewed weekly by the Resizely core team. To unlock the emergency keystore, enter the recovery passphrase below.

vault phrase of fafop-kagug = zorox-zorwyn

## Baseline ownership

The file `lintgate.baseline.json` pins known findings for the Quarrel static analyzer. Plugin authors must not edit it directly; new findings from your plugin belong in your own suppression file. Baseline regeneration happens only at minor releases, via `quarrel baseline --refresh`. If your plugin legitimately requires a baseline change, request it from the maintainer named below.

named custodian: Brivan Eliath Quenox Frador

## Limits and Quotas — Brindlemoor Telemetry Gateway

Welcome aboard. The gateway enforces per-device and per-fleet quotas to protect the ingest tier during harvest season, when tractor units report far more frequently. Exceeding a quota returns a throttle response with a retry hint; devices must back off. The enforced limits are defined as constants here.

tuning constants:
THRESHOLDS = {
    "ruswyn": 100,
    "rusion": 627,
    "gorys": 926,
    "ulaion": 461,
    "zorwyn": 843,
    "gilys": 882,
    "rusvan": 45,
}